Abstract

We consider the following property for a group G:(RZn)ifH1,…,Hnare finitely generated subgroups of G then the setH1 H2⋯ Hn= {h1 ⋯ hn| h1∈ H1, …,hn∈ Hn}is closed with respect to the profinite topology of G. It is obvious that finite groups and finitely generated commutative groups have the property ( RZ n). L. Ribes and P. Zalesskiĭ proved that any free group has ( RZ n). We show that the property ( RZ n) is stable under the free product operation. We use techniques developed by B. Herwig and D. Lascar on the one hand, R. Gitik on the other hand.
